
Apple iPad with Samsung OLED panel may debut in 2024
India Today
As Apple marks a shift to OLED screens for its devices, Samsung may be the one to supply these panels to Apple soon. There is, however, one big condition to be met here.
A future iPad by Apple may sport an OLED panel provided by Samsung. If a recent report is to be believed, the latter is already working on setting up the production line for such OLED panels and may be able to have it in place by next year. It is then anticipated to debut in an iPad by 2024.
The report comes from The Elec, and states that Apple will need to order a substantial number of these OLED panels from Samsung, so that it can break even in the production process. Only a "large enough order" will make the deal financially viable for Samsung.
